What do you do when it's raining in June? Bake the world's best cookies!
![](https://blogger.googleusercontent.com/img/b/R29vZ2xl/AVvXsEh17GRbt-zpMrk3q483EOND_PLqpxu8OMk1iOO7-io9pWcCYOBwyoigEkPN5UkjcPHt7Kt2bY2iaGnRtTlwpna4RKyoPUc0ujlkCdCzYOzLYgjrt68t5-92dTt-fuUy93T1ThgW6UrBw38x/s1600/chocchipcookies.jpg)
Ingredients
150g butter, room temperature
1 1/2 cup sugar
1 egg
2 cups all purpose flour
1 tsp baking powder
1 tsp salt
230g of chocolate*
For the dark/chocolate cookies, add 2 tbsps cocoa and 1/4 cup extra sugar
* use your favourite milk, dark or white chocolate broken into chunks, or chocolate chips, Smarties, raisins, chopped apricots or a combination of anything you want!
Method
Pre-heat the oven to 165C.
Cream butter and sugar.
Add the egg and beat/combine well.
Sift in flour and baking powder. Add salt.
Combine well.
Mix in the choc chips (or whatever you're using).
On a baking tray (preferably on baking paper), using a teaspoon, place small amounts of the mixture approximately 2cms apart.
Bake in the middle of the oven for 10-12 minutes or until golden.
Allow to cool before removing from the paper onto a cooling tray.
Makes approximately 30 cookies.
